WPS表格的宏功能使用实例
在现代办公环境中,效率和自动化是提升工作质量和速度的重要因素。WPS表格作为一款优秀的电子表格软件,具备了强大的宏功能,使用户能够通过编写宏来自动化重复性任务,提高工作效率。本文将通过实例详细介绍WPS表格的宏功能如何使用。
什么是宏功能?
宏是一组可以自动执行的指令,用于简化重复的操作。在WPS表格中,用户可以通过录制宏或手动编写VBA(Visual Basic for Applications)代码来实现定制化的功能。当你需要频繁执行特定的操作时,宏将大大减少所需的时间和精力。
实例:批量处理数据
假设你正在处理一份包含大量销售数据的表格,需求是将所有销售额超过5000的记录标记为“高销售额”。传统方法是逐行检查并手动标记,这样既耗时又容易出错。使用宏功能,我们可以实现这一过程的自动化。
步骤一:录制宏
1. 打开WPS表格,加载你的数据文件。
2. 在菜单栏上找到“视图”,点击“宏”,然后选择“录制宏”。
3. 将宏命名为“标记高销售”,并选择保存位置,可以选择在当前工作簿中保存。
4. 点击“确定”后,开始录制宏。在表格中,逐行查看销售额,并在符合条件的单元格旁边输入“高销售额”。
步骤二:停止录制
当你完成操作后,再次点击“视图”中的“宏”,选择“停止录制”。此时,WPS会自动生成相应的VBA代码。
步骤三:执行宏
要执行刚才录制的宏,重复进入“视图” -> “宏” -> “查看宏”,选择“标记高销售”,点击“运行”。系统会自动按照录制时的步骤,将所有销售额超过5000的数据标记出来。
步骤四:手动编辑宏(可选)
如果你熟悉VBA代码,可以对录制的宏进行手动编辑。例如,你可以调整条件,让它不仅适用于5000,甚至可以将标记的文字改为更红的颜色。此时,你可以在宏编辑器中修改代码:
```vba
Sub 标记高销售()
Dim cell As Range
For Each cell In Range("A2:A100") ' 假设销售额在A2到A100之间
If cell.Value > 5000 Then
cell.Offset(0, 1).Value = "高销售额" ' 在旁边单元格标记
cell.Offset(0, 1).Interior.Color = RGB(255, 0, 0) ' 将标记单元格背景颜色改为红色
End If
Next cell
End Sub
```
总结
通过以上实例,我们可以看到,WPS表格的宏功能不仅提高了数据处理的自动化程度,也极大地提升了工作效率。无论是数据分析、报表生成还是其他重复性任务,使用宏都能帮助我们节省时间、减少错误、提升工作质量。熟练掌握宏的使用,将为你的日常办公带来更多便利。在此基础上,用户还可以进一步深入学习VBA编程,开发出更多符合个人需求的功能,以实现更高效的办公体验。